4. Picnic at Point Pleasant Park
After hitting up the market, head down the street to Point Pleasant Park for green space, water views and an abundance of walking and biking paths.
You can catch alot of action on the water from the harbour here and find a little solace in the city.

6. Take the Ferry to Dartmouth and Explore Dartmouth’s “Brooklyn-by-the-Sea” Side
For a few bucks you can cross the water and head to Dartmouth. The downtown area has some of our favorite local stops;
Croissants at Two if By Sea, Small plates, incredible cocktails and the most intimate patio at Dear Friend Bar, paddling at Lake Banook, and the best slice of ‘ZA at Yeah Yeahs. We are big fans of Audrey’s plant shop and highly recommend checking them out.
Dartmouth has a growing food and beverage scene and a beautiful waterfront walk.

7. Visit the Halifax Brewery Market downtown Halifax
This market has our hearts located in a historic downtown building filled with Local produce, Artisan products, Fresh flowers, Kombucha vendors
and Wellness products. We recommend the fresh made pasta, beautiful flower bunches and freshly made organic coffee. Every Saturday morning this is a NOT TO BE MISSED!
